The Power of Passion with Matthew Donnell Kick Ball Change Podcast

    • Arts

Join this creative and talented dance educator/leading professional in the ballet world as he takes us through his Kick Ball Change moments in life. Dive into how they became a foundation for his training, his family, career, and professional journey, which most recently receiving approval by the Balanchine Trust to perform the full “Who Cares?” for the Cary Ballet Conservatory.


From early Kick Ball Change moments of having to use a padlock on his school bag, to having a universal chance to audition for a company director he denied previously. Donnell talks openly about how ego can be a catalyst for young dancers, and as he takes you through his journey of how he let go of his ego of the TOP 5 dance companies to be in, and how that opened the doors to principle dancer, securing contracts for companies dancers in the future and becoming a leading educator with the prestige Cary Ballet Conservatory. His involved work onstage has carried him through the supportive training he offers, as well as his engagement with the ORZA ballet shoe which is using corrective technology to keeps ballet dancers healthy. https://orzabrand.com/collections/orza-pro-one
